Turning Luck into Livelihood: Cruise Ship Casino Host Incomes
Life aboard a cruise ship is often romanticized as a life of leisure and luxury. However, behind the glitz and glamour lies a world of hard work and dedication, especially for those who play a role in keeping the casino decks thriving. Cruise Ship Casino Hosts are vital players in this environment, responsible for cultivating an exciting and engaging atmosphere for guests while ensuring a smooth and successful operation for the ship.
Their duties range from greeting guests, providing them with information about games and promotions, to offering personalized service. They also play a crucial role in building relationships with high-rollers, recognizing potential players, and organizing exclusive experiences.
So, what can you look forward to in terms of compensation? Cruise Ship Casino Host salaries differ based on a number of factors, including experience level, the size and reputation of the cruise line, and the host's individual results.
- Entry-level hosts may earn roughly $25,000-$40,000 per year, while experienced hosts with a proven track record can command well over $60,000 annually.
- In addition to their base salary, many casino hosts also receive tips based on their performance in increasing revenue for the casino.
- The potential for advancement is also present, with top performers sometimes being advanced to supervisory roles or even management positions.
